Biography

John Lund (6 February 1911 - 10 May 1992) was an American film actor who is probably best remembered for his role in the film A Foreign Affair (1948), directed by Billy Wilder. Description above from the Wikipedia article John Lund, licensed under CC-BY-SA, full list of contributors on Wikipedia
